From 225d3fa258ff48d2349ae890d2ee4fbc2f288f6c Mon Sep 17 00:00:00 2001 From: Louis Date: Sun, 12 Oct 2025 18:44:27 +0200 Subject: [PATCH] #737 - fix language prop when using existing text model (#738) --- src/Editor/Editor.tsx | 6 ++++-- 1 file changed, 4 insertions(+), 2 deletions(-) diff --git a/src/Editor/Editor.tsx b/src/Editor/Editor.tsx index c53f2d6..c16ffff 100644 --- a/src/Editor/Editor.tsx +++ b/src/Editor/Editor.tsx @@ -118,9 +118,11 @@ function Editor({ useUpdate( () => { const model = editorRef.current?.getModel(); - if (model && language) monacoRef.current?.editor.setModelLanguage(model, language); + if (isEditorReady && model && language) { + monacoRef.current?.editor.setModelLanguage(model, language); + } }, - [language], + [language, isEditorReady], isEditorReady, );